Gombe Governor, Inuwa Yahaya, Heads APC’s 495-member National Campaign Council For The November 11 Bayelsa Governorship Election

September 22, 2023

Gombe State Governor, His Excellency, Muhammad Inuwa Yahaya heads the Party’s 495-member National Campaign Council for the 11th November, Bayelsa State Governorship Election.

The inauguration committee holds on Friday, Sept. 29, at the Lady Daima Memorial Event Place, Yenagoa, 12 noon.
